Q. When virtual memory is executed in a computing system there are convinced costs associated with the technique and certain benefits. List the costs as well as the benefits. Is it probable for the costs to surpass the benefits? If it is what measures can be taken to ensure that this doesn't happen?

Answer: The costs are additional hardware in addition to slower access time. The benefits are good use of memory and larger logical address space than physical address space.
